PESHAWAR: Three newly appointed additional judges of the Peshawar High Court (PHC) took oath of their offices here on Friday. PHC Chief Justice Qaiser Rashid Khan administered the oath to Justice Kamran Hayat Miankhel, Justice Ijaz Khan and Justice Muhammad Faheem Wali. The oath taking ceremony was attended by the senior judges of PHC and Advocate General, Additional Advocate General General Khyber Pakhtunkhwa.
